CVE-2016-8233

CVSS 9.8v3.0pub. 2017-03-01upd. 2026-05-13

Log files generated by Lenovo XClarity Administrator (LXCA) versions earlier than 1.2.2 may contain user credentials in a non-secure, clear text form that could be viewed by a non-privileged user.
